Output 1058c70bab4ee71fe3f33e79588395021d04feb0326f4f0f193d2a81dcab5b10:4

value
845741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ee636601b94e0dcb56a911efce751e094aa9602b OP_EQUAL
address
3PRVpXSppva7zWt58An65jVGaQdu3h3Pvs
transaction
1058c70bab4ee71fe3f33e79588395021d04feb0326f4f0f193d2a81dcab5b10
confirmations
272959
spent
true